WebJan 29, 2015 · Angioedema induced by treatment with angiotensin-converting–enzyme (ACE) inhibitors is estimated to occur in up to 0.68% of patients who receive ACE inhibitors, 1-5 although the true incidence ... WebFeb 21, 2024 · Usually, angiotensin-converting enzyme inhibitor–induced angioedema (ACEia) presents itself as swelling without urticaria, most prevalent in the face, lips, tongue, the floor of the mouth, and the upper airways, leading to hoarseness, inability to swallow, and difficulty of breathing.

WebJun 8, 2024 · Angiotensin-converting enzyme inhibitors (ACE-I), a medication class used by an estimated 40 million people worldwide, are associated with angioedema that occurs with incidence ranging from 0.1 to 0.7%. The widespread use of ACE-I resulted in one third of all emergency department visits for angioedema. WebMar 10, 2024 · ACE inhibitors induce angioedema in 0.1 to 0.7 percent of recipients, with data suggesting a persistent and relatively constant risk over time [1-11].
